Key Points

  • '​Pure' plants refer to the homozygous condition in plants and 'hybrid' refers to the heterozygous plants.
  • Homozygous - It is the condition in which the pair of alleles determining a phenotype is identical, either both dominant (TT) or both recessive (tt).
  • Heterozygous - It is the condition where 2 different types of alleles are present, one dominant and one recessive (Tt).
  • When a pure tall plant (TT) is crossed with a pure short plant (tt), the F1 generation produces heterozygous tall (Tt) plants.
  • Upon selfing the F1 generation, that is, crossing two heterozygous tall plants, the following numbers of the F2 generation are obtained phenotypically:
    • Three tall plants and one short plant
  • Whereas, genotypically, the following ratio is obtained:
    • One pure tall plant, two heterozygous tall plants, and one pure short plant.
  • Therefore, considering the genotype, the ratio of pure tall plants to pure short plants in the F2 generation is 1:1. Hence, Option 1 is correct.

Mistake Points

  • Please note here that the question asks about the ratio of "pure" tall plants to short plants in F2 generation.
  • The usual ratio of 3:1 is for "all" tall plants to short plants.
  • Pure Tall plants : Hybrid Tall plants : Short/Dwarf plants = TT : Tt : tt = 1:2:1
  • Therefore, Pure tall : Pure short = 1:1
